As a member of the ARLIS/NA Communications and Publications Committee (CPC), the Media Relations Coordinator
will manage public awareness of ARLIS/NA initiatives, events, and other
programs. The Coordinator will deliver key messages to external
audiences about the value of the Society’s mission to foster excellence
in art and design librarianship and image management, as well as all
supporting activities. The Media Relations Coordinator will also
work in conjunction with association management company and other
ARLIS/NA committees to plan and implement tools to increase ARLIS/NA’s
profile outside its current membership and core audience.
Duties:
-Actively investigate new strategies and opportunities for outreach and communication through all forms of media.
-Enhance effectiveness of press and publicity function.
-Work
with various chairs, moderators, coordinators, and other ARLIS/NA
leadership to ensure timely and effective dissemination of information
and news.
-Coordinate with Association Manager and publication partners to promote ARLIS/NA's activities and publications.
-Liaison with AWS Editor, News & Features Editor, and Association
Manager in order to develop effective communication policies to ensure
messaging continuity.
-Shape the prominence and role of ARLIS members in the media.
-Ensure press releases are generated and delivered in a timely matter to relevant outlets.
-Maintain and update media contact list.
